Maine Black Bears (stud): Tactical Approach and Current Form

The Maine Black Bears come into this matchup with an impressive record over their last five games, boasting a 4-1 run that has sparked excitement among their fanbase. Their style of play revolves around a high-paced offense, utilizing fast breaks and aggressive perimeter shooting. They rank highly in three-point attempts, with a solid conversion rate of 35%, which will be a key factor in breaking down Binghamton’s defense. Additionally, their ball movement has been fluid, with an average of 16 assists per game, demonstrating excellent team chemistry and an ability to create open shots. Their rebounding, particularly offensive boards, has been one of their strong points, as they average 13.4 offensive rebounds per game. This allows them second-chance opportunities, which will be crucial in a game that might come down to possession control.

Defensively, Maine has been solid, focusing on disrupting passing lanes and applying pressure to force turnovers. Their defensive efficiency has been impressive, ranking in the top half of the NCAA in steals per game (7.1). This ability to create chaos in transition could lead to easy points against a Binghamton team that has struggled with ball security at times.

Key players to watch for Maine include their star guard, who has been outstanding in creating shots both for himself and teammates. His ability to score under pressure will be critical. Also, their forward, who has been a dominant force in the paint, is expected to continue his role as both a scorer and a rim protector, averaging 2.5 blocks per game. Injuries have not been a major issue for the Black Bears, but they will need to manage the minutes of their key players to avoid fatigue as the tournament progresses.

Binghamton (stud): Tactical Approach and Current Form

Binghamton enters this contest with a mixed record of 3-2 in their last five games. However, their recent losses have come against some of the tournament’s toughest opponents, which has highlighted their ability to compete at a high level. Their style of play is more methodical compared to Maine’s fast-paced offense, focusing on controlling the tempo and limiting high-scoring affairs. They have a solid half-court offense led by their experienced point guard, who runs the show with precise pick-and-roll executions and excellent court vision. Binghamton has relied heavily on mid-range shooting, with a success rate of 42%, which could be a crucial weapon against a Maine defense that tends to close out hard on the three-point line.

On the defensive end, Binghamton prefers to set up in a zone defense, which has shown promise in slowing down more potent offenses. Their ability to contest shots without fouling has kept their opponents' field goal percentage down, and their rebounding, particularly on the defensive end (averaging 28.7 defensive rebounds per game), helps them limit second-chance opportunities. This will be critical against Maine's offensive rebounding prowess.

In terms of key players, Binghamton's forward has been their most consistent scorer, often capitalizing on mismatches in the post. His ability to finish around the basket and draw fouls will be key to keeping the Black Bears’ defense on their heels. Binghamton has faced some injury concerns recently, with one of their key bench players sidelined, which could affect their depth, but they have managed to adapt well in his absence.

Head-to-Head: History and Psychology

In the last three encounters between Maine and Binghamton, both teams have shared victories, but the contests have been highly competitive, with each side having moments of dominance. Historically, Maine has been slightly more potent offensively, but Binghamton’s defense has held firm in tight games. Their most recent clash saw Maine pull off a narrow victory in a fast-paced encounter, while Binghamton claimed a win in a defensive battle earlier in the season. The psychology of this matchup will be fascinating, as Maine will look to impose their style of high tempo, while Binghamton will aim to slow the game down and grind out a win. The ability of each team to execute their preferred game plan will play a significant role in determining the outcome.
